Kisschasy is an Australian rock band formed in Victoria in 2002. The lineup has consisted of lead vocalist Darren Cordeux, bassist Joel Vanderuit, guitarist Sean Thomas and drummer Karl Ammitzboll since the band's inception. They achieved notable success in Australia during the 2000s with their energetic and melodic sound, influenced by post-punk and indie rock. Some of their most popular songs include "The Last Time", "Gold" and "You Can't Stop Me". Their debut album, "Kisschasy", was released in 2004 and helped solidify their popularity.
